The diameter of Saturn at its equator is approximately 121,000. Write this number scientific notation.

2 Answers

5 votes

121, 000

Let 121,000 = 1.21 by moving the decimal point 5 units to the left.

Moving to the left creates a positive power.

Multiply by 10.

1.21 x 10^5

Answer:

1.21 * 10^5

Explanation:

Move the decimal so there is one non-zero digit to the left of the decimal point. The number of decimal places you move will be the exponent on the 10.

If the decimal is being moved to the right, the exponent will be negative. If the decimal is being moved to the left, the exponent will be positive.
